Abstract:
Higher-order calculations are the backbone of precision predictions in
particle
physics. In this presentation, I want to offer three possible topics:

•⁠  ⁠The four-loop rho parameter and elliptic integrals
 The rho parameter is an important electroweak precision observable. At
 three-loop order, the QCD corrections have been shown to contain
 elliptic Feynman integrals. Let's explore what lies beyond!

•⁠  ⁠N-jettiness beam functions at N3LO in QCD
 The current frontier for differential distributions at the LHC are
 N3LO corrections. These predictions require intricate schemes to deal
 with singularities from soft and collinear radiation. Beam functions
 describe effects of collinear radiation along the incoming beams and
 constitute an important building block in these schemes. Let's see how
 to calculate them!

•⁠  ⁠Massive operator matrix elements for PDFs and DIS
 When massless quarks become massive, many curious things happen.
 Massive operator matrix elements connect massless and massive
 descriptions of quarks in the context of parton distribution functions
 and deep-inelastic scattering.
 While calculating them, we discover three spaces, connected by Mellin
 transformations, generating functions and discontinuities and find an
 interesting connection to the optical theorem.
